Exclusion Criteria
Past history of allergy for local anesthetics. Past history of contact dermatitis. Dermal abnormality on the puncture sites. Severe hepatic, renal or cardiovascular disease. Methemogulobinemia Porphyria Pregnancy or lactation period Communication difficulty Sensory disturbance Anesthesiologist or attending physician determine that the patient is inappropriate for this study.
